Job Description Shift : 2nd
Job Responsibilities: (Primary Duties, Roles, and/or Authorities)
Perform assembly, packaging, and labeling of medical devices and pharmaceutical products (e.g., Surgical, Vascular) in compliance with GMP, SOPs, and quality standards.
Operate and be certified in multiple manufacturing processes or groups of operations across different areas.
Execute production activities using batch records, job aids, SOPs, and product specifications.
Interpret manufacturing documentation to ensure accurate and efficient process execution.
Perform in-process and final visual inspections to ensure product and packaging meet quality requirements.
Accurately complete and review batch records, production logs, and documentation in compliance with GMP, GDP, FDA, and ISO standards.
Meet daily production targets in alignment with the established day-by-hour production plan.
Monitor, capture, and report downtime, scrap, and production performance metrics.
Coordinate execution of manufacturing schedules for assigned batches or operations.
Ensure availability of required materials before initiating operations.
Handle, segregate, and dispose of non-conforming materials in accordance with established procedures.
Maintain cleanliness and organization of work areas, equipment, and operations in alignment with 5S and cleanroom standards.
Support manufacturing-related activities including calibration, work orders, and validation processes as required .
Identify , troubleshoot, and communicate production issues, risks, or deviations to the supervisor or designee in a timely manner .
Support and maintain a safe work environment, including participation in safety programs such as Employee Safety Observations (ESO).
Follow all safety requirements and properly use personal protective equipment (PPE), including but not limited to lab coats, gloves, hair/beard covers, shoe covers, hearing protection, eye protection, and specialized cleanroom garments as required .
Provide guidance, training, and knowledge sharing to other associates as needed.
Support continuous improvement initiatives, including 5S, standardization, and process simplification.
Provide backup support across multiple equipment, operations, or areas as required .
Communicate issues, concerns, and potential risks that may impact product quality or manufacturing processes.
Comply with all company policies and regulatory requirements.
Perform other duties as assigned.
